Output 91048dd1db3cfb58ed5ba9314d69b3ebd1cfe915a48d0f2c1e142a5142dfeda7:3

value
30590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fa02626345861408c275859a3c18f99487559dc OP_EQUAL
address
337dumdJ9NZJR5PrAsgt9PETUGLQqfaB13
transaction
91048dd1db3cfb58ed5ba9314d69b3ebd1cfe915a48d0f2c1e142a5142dfeda7
confirmations
140737
spent
true